Как ввести информацию о моей ссылке в html5 из файла swiffy, созданного из файла флэш-памяти?

Я создаю баннерную рекламу во Flash CS5 с AS 2 и преобразовываю ее в html5 с помощью swiffy, у меня есть кнопка с меткой клика во flash, но где я могу ввести информацию о ссылке для моей метки клика - в html, в вспышка или это еще ввод?

4 ответа

Решение

Я хотел бы добавить кое-что:

для запуска этого flash/html5 через рекламный сервер URL-адрес внутри флэш-памяти не имеет большого значения, у вас может быть один внутри флэш-памяти, а другой - на стороне кода; Клик будет использовать тот, что на стороне кода.

Так что вы можете иметь внутри вспышки:

on (release) {
getURL("http://www.msn.com", "_blank");
}

и после преобразования соответствующий код будет:

"actions":[{"value":"http://www.msn.com","type":305},{"value":"_blank","type":305}

Теперь вы можете заменить URL-адрес следующим образом:

"actions":[{"value":"http://www.google.com","type":305},{"value":"_blank","type":305}

и баннер будет идти в Google вместо того, чтобы идти в MSN.

обратите внимание, что я также добавил цель _blank.

ура

Вы также можете использовать js для связи контейнера:

<head>
    <script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.3/jquery.min.js"></script>    
</head>

$('#swiffycontainer').click(function() {
            window.location.href = "http://yourWebSite.co.il
    });

Я делаю много рекламных баннеров на Flash, но мне никогда не приходится предоставлять HTML-код издателю, а только.swf и резервную копию.gif. Спецификации издателей сильно различаются, но, как правило, при предоставлении издателю сообщают им URL-адрес, на который нужно перенаправить метку клика. Это издатель, который будет реализовывать URL. Надеюсь, это поможет:)

Я только что сделал кнопку AS 2 с

on(release) {
getURL('http://www.google.com');
}

Экспортируется как SWF и загружается в конвертер Swiffy от Google. Сгенерирован HTML5-код ​​со ссылкой (фрагмент):

"actions":[{"value":"http://www.google.com","type":305},

Кнопка работает. Итак, поместите ссылку в исходный файл Flash. Если вам когда-либо понадобится изменить URL-адрес, вы можете сделать это, отредактировав текстовый файл html.

Другие вопросы по тегам